WebApr 13, 2024 · Then stretch the syllable out to finish the word and ease out of the stutter. It should sound like “taaaaalking.”. 7 ways to support someone who stutters. Watch on. 5. Slow speech. When we take time to slow down our speech, this automatically helps improve speech fluency. We can slow speech down in a few ways. WebFeb 6, 2024 · 4. Once students understand the speech mechanism, we can talk about what happens when we stutter. We can move through the different parts of the speech mechanism and talk about what would happen if the different components are tight versus loose.* literature came from what latin word
